The scientists developed a medley of molecules that, when injected into biological tissue, chemically reacted with naturally occurring compounds equivalent to glucose and lactase to form an electrically conducting gel. The Swedish researchers first created electronic roses in 2015. However, plant cells possess rigid partitions that may function scaffolding to help electrodes kind, whereas animal cells lack such structures. Making a mixture of compounds that could form electronics in animals took years of work. In experiments, the scientists created gel electrodes in the brain, heart, and tail fins of living zebra fish with no signs of tissue damage. In addition, they showed that the electrically conducting gel might link nerves in medicinal leeches with electrodes on a tiny flexible probe. Moreover, they might develop these electrodes in cow, swine, and rooster muscle. "With electronics and electrodes formed inside biological methods, invasiveness ought to be relatively a lot decrease and even zero, in comparison with introducing onerous and rigid customary electronics into soft tissues," says research senior author Magnus Berggren, a material scientist at Linköping University in Sweden. The neoconservatives have been around for a very long time and eventually in 1997 created a company headed by William Kristol and considerably grandiosely titled The Project for the new American Century (PNAC). Their mission statement could be found on its webpage. The Project for the new American Century is a non-revenue educational group dedicated to a few fundamental propositions: that American leadership is nice both for America and for the world; and that such leadership requires military power, diplomatic power and commitment to ethical principle. The PNAC intends, by way of difficulty briefs, research papers, advocacy journalism, conferences, and seminars, to clarify what American world management entails. It will also attempt to rally support for a vigorous and principled policy of American international involvement and to stimulate helpful public debate on international and protection coverage and America’s function on the earth. Laycock de Normanville overdrive, controlled by a faciamounted toggle switch, natural testosterone booster appeared as a brand new option, and Borg-Warner automated transmission was offered at further price late in the mannequin run, which ended in early 1957. This automotive might spring from 0-60 mph in about eight seconds and was some 5 mph faster flat out than its 120 predecessor. However, under stress from American legislation enforcement authorities, Jaguar was pressured to muzzle the lovely exhaust word on its tuned engine from a roar to a relative purr. A altering market hastened the XK-140's replacement, which debuted in mid-1957 as the XK-150. This last variation on Sir William's beautiful original design theme was Jaguar's direct reply to cars just like the BMW 507 and the Mercedes-Benz 300SL, which offered similar performance and roadability whereas better catering to the rising American demand for more refinement and comfort. Accordingly, the one hundred fifty was plusher and more civilized than any previous XK. The fundamental bodyshell was substantially restyled with greater front fenders, a wider grille, and a curved one-piece windshield.

The NIH names tennis as one among the burden-bearing actions effectively suited to constructing sturdy bones. Bone mass is straight affected by what elements of the physique you're exercising. So, when you train only your legs, you may be constructing bone mass only within the legs. That does not imply tennis doesn't offer you a full body workout and will not improve bone well being all through your body -- it just means your dominant arm gets just a little extra of the action. Running, swinging, reaching, pivoting -- tennis could be an actual workout with the right opponent. It's a complete-physique sport, and you'll burn a whole lot of calories because you are always on the transfer. To lose a pound of fat, it is advisable to burn approximately an extra 3,500 calories. If taking part in singles tennis for one hour burns about 600 calories for a man and 420 calories for a lady, playing about three to 4 hours of tennis each week might aid you lose round half a pound per week.
